Transaction 1ccfb3e4679c4baeff04259541901fd58e6d38b5da38fc406538772478ef4ea1

1 Input
2 Outputs
  • 1ccfb3e4679c4baeff04259541901fd58e6d38b5da38fc406538772478ef4ea1:0
  • value  3297362
    address  3KVNARSjiqKLQKYRdHATGTA2fh5BiWzBL9
  • 1ccfb3e4679c4baeff04259541901fd58e6d38b5da38fc406538772478ef4ea1:1
  • value  1896670538
    address  31w3iWUN5EMJMW2YRCc5m4RFqm3zN61xK2